//Bits 3-5 of IR denote addressing mode of instruction
int irAddressMode = (ir >> 2) & 0x07;通过使用0x03对ir中保存的值进行ANDing,我们只剩下位模式中的第6-7位的值(以小端字节顺序工作)。然而,我不理解第一行中需要>>运算符,为什么在ANDing之前需要先执行(ir >> 2),才能找到ir变量中第3-5位的值?
我想确保我的概念是正确的:
在Hadoop the Definite中有这样的说法:“设计文件系统的目标总是减少寻道的数量,而不是要传输的数据量。”在这个声明中,作者指的是Hadoop逻辑块的“寻道()”,对吗?我在想,无论Hadoop块大小有多大(64MB或128MB或更大),底层文件系统(例如ext3/fat)必须执行的物理块(通常是4KB或8KB)的寻道数量将是相同的,无论Hadoop块大小如何。如果Hadoop数据块大小增加到128MB,则文件系统执行的寻道次数仍为128。在第二种情况下,Hadoop将执